O positive blood is one of the most common blood types found in the human population. Approximately 37% of people in the United States have O positive blood, making it the most prevalent type overall. This blood type is determined by two main factors: the presence or absence of A and B antigens on red blood cells, and the presence of the Rh factor (the "positive" designation).

The "O" in O positive means that a person's red blood cells lack both the A and B antigens. These antigens are proteins and sugars on the cell surface that the immune system recognizes as either "self" or "foreign." When someone has O positive blood, their immune system has naturally developed antibodies against A and B antigens, which means their body would react negatively if exposed to blood containing these antigens.
The "positive" part refers to the Rh factor, a protein found on the surface of red blood cells. About 85% of the population carries this Rh protein, which is why positive blood types are more common than negative types. People with O positive blood inherited two recessive O genes from their parents—one from each parent—and at least one gene for the Rh positive factor.

Research has suggested that people with O positive blood type may have certain health patterns that differ from other blood types. Some studies indicate that O blood type carriers may have lower blood clotting factors, which can affect bleeding and clotting risks differently than other blood types. However, it is crucial to understand that having O positive blood does not determine your individual health outcomes—many other factors including genetics, lifestyle, age, and medical history play significant roles.

A notable study published in medical research journals found that people with O blood type may have a lower risk of blood clots compared to other blood types, but this does not mean O positive individuals are immune to clotting disorders. Individual variation is significant, and many people with O positive blood experience normal clotting function throughout their lives. Conversely, some people with this blood type may have bleeding disorders or other conditions unrelated to their blood type classification.
Some research has examined connections between blood type and susceptibility to certain infectious diseases. Historical data suggested that people with O blood type might have different susceptibility levels to conditions like cholera and plague, though modern living conditions and medical care have largely eliminated these as concerns in developed countries. More recent studies have investigated potential links between blood type and conditions like heart disease and diabetes, but results remain inconclusive and are not definitive enough to make individual health predictions.
Medical professionals emphasize that blood type is one small piece of health information and should not be used to make assumptions about an individual's current or future health status. Regular medical check-ups, screenings appropriate for your age and risk factors, and discussions with your doctor about your family health history provide far more meaningful information for understanding your personal health risks. Your blood type is useful primarily in medical emergencies, surgical situations, and pregnancy planning.

Your blood type should be documented in your medical records, and understanding why this information matters can help you manage your healthcare more effectively. When you visit a hospital, undergo surgery, or receive emergency medical care, knowing your blood type allows medical staff to provide appropriate treatment quickly. In emergency situations where seconds matter, having your blood type readily available can prevent delays in transfusions or other critical procedures.

Many people carry medical ID cards or wear medical alert bracelets that include their blood type information. This practice is particularly important for people who may be unable to communicate during medical emergencies. Additionally, modern medical records systems increasingly include blood type information in electronic health records that healthcare providers can access across different facilities and hospitals. Some people choose to register their blood type with medical alert services or keep a blood type card in their wallet.
If you do not know your blood type, you can learn it through several common methods. A simple blood test at a doctor's office, hospital, or blood donation center can determine your blood type within minutes. Blood donation centers often provide this information to donors at no cost, making blood donations an opportunity to confirm your blood type while contributing to the blood supply. Some online services now offer mail-in blood type testing, though these should come from reputable medical laboratories.
